A young Hutterite boy is forced to marry his late brother's rebellious girlfriend, who tries to escape their community. They get caught up in a search for stolen money, learning to live together despite their differences.

Heads up

  • Some comedic chases and minor peril
  • Brief discussions of crime and theft
  • Mentions of underage marriage, though handled comically
